**Digital Dynamics: Online Communities Beat Down Barriers**
While social media often gets a bad rap for fostering echo chambers, the data tells a different story. Online communities frequently bring together individuals with niche interests that would otherwise remain solitary. The anonymity of the internet reduces social anxiety, allowing authentic connections that can spill over into offline support systems.

**Civic Science: Communities as Natural Laboratories**
Urban neighborhoods function as living experiments. By observing how residents collaborate on street repairs, garden projects, or neighborhood watch programs, scientists can model emergent problem‑solving behaviors. These insights help predict how communities will adapt to climate change, economic shifts, or public health crises.

**Future Fabric: Communities Reshape the Economy**
The gig economy’s rise has birthed “platform communities” where freelancers band together to share resources, knowledge, and client referrals. These digital collectives create new economic ecosystems that operate outside traditional corporate hierarchies, illustrating how community can drive innovation and resilience.
